Thanks. Several things are weird here:
1) I cannot reproduce the failure on Cygwin nor MinGW over here.
The test passes with current HEAD.
2) Your log (thanks!) shows this essential difference to a log of mine
on GNU/Linux:
+ tmp_libs=
+ test unknown '!=' no
+ test link = link
+ test lib = prog
-+ compiler_flags=' Cocoa.ltframework ApplicationServices.ltframework'
-+
dependency_libs='/usr/src/libtool/cvs/_build/tests/testsuite.dir/09/libboth.la '
+++ echo 'X Cocoa.ltframework ApplicationServices.ltframework'
+++ /bin/sed -e '1s/^X//' -e 's% \([^ $]*\).ltframework% -framework \1%g'
++ compiler_flags=' -framework Cocoa -framework ApplicationServices'
++ dependency_libs='/tmp/build/tests/testsuite.dir/09/libboth.la '
+ test link = dlpreopen
+ test link '!=' dlopen
+ test link '!=' conv
+ lib_search_path=
This looks to me like you don't have this code in your ltmain.m4sh, or
libtool wasn't updated properly afterwards:
if test "$pass" = link; then
if test "$linkmode" = "prog"; then
compile_deplibs="$new_inherited_linker_flags $compile_deplibs"
finalize_deplibs="$new_inherited_linker_flags $finalize_deplibs"
else
compiler_flags="$compiler_flags "`$ECHO "X
$new_inherited_linker_flags" | $Xsed -e 's% \([^ $]*\).ltframework% -framework
\1%g'`
fi
fi
You could grep for 'compiler_flags=.*ltframework' to find out.
Note that only shortly before the patch in question, a patch was applied
to fix Makefile rebuilding rules of `libtool' from `ltmain.m4sh' by way
of `ltmain.sh', so an older Makefile version could have generated that.
Could you try again with an up to date tree
make check-local TESTSUITEFLAGS='-v -d -x 9'
and see if things work now for you?
